Starting A Business Guideline

Starting a business is an exciting journey that offers the potential for financial independence, personal fulfillment, and the opportunity to bring innovative ideas to life. However, launching a business requires careful planning, strategic decision-making, and a thorough understanding of the steps involved. Whether you're a first-time entrepreneur or looking to refine your process, this comprehensive guide will walk you through the essential stages of starting a business, from initial idea development to launching and growing your enterprise.

Conduct Market Research and Validate Your Business Idea

Before diving into the logistics of starting a business, it’s crucial to validate your idea through thorough market research. This step helps you understand your target audience, identify competitors, and assess the demand for your product or service.

  • Identify your target market: Define who your ideal customers are, including demographics, preferences, and buying behaviors.
  • Analyze competitors: Study existing businesses offering similar products or services. Understand their strengths and weaknesses to find your unique selling proposition.
  • Assess demand: Conduct surveys, interviews, or online research to gauge interest and willingness to pay for your offering.
  • Refine your idea: Use insights gathered to adjust your product or service to better meet market needs.

Create a Solid Business Plan

A well-crafted business plan serves as a roadmap for your business, guiding your strategies, operations, and financial planning. It is also essential when seeking funding or partnerships.

  • Executive summary: Summarize your business idea, target market, and objectives.
  • Business description: Detail what your business does, your mission, and your vision.
  • Market analysis: Present findings from your market research, including industry trends and competitive landscape.
  • Organization and management: Define your business structure, ownership, and team members.
  • Products or services: Describe what you offer, including features, benefits, and development stages.
  • Marketing and sales strategy: Outline how you will attract and retain customers.
  • Financial projections: Include budgets, forecasts, and break-even analysis.

Choose a Business Structure and Register Your Business

Selecting the right legal structure is vital for your business’s legal, tax, and liability considerations. Common options include sole proprietorship, partnership, LLC, or corporation.

  • Sole Proprietorship: Simplest form, suitable for small businesses with minimal risk.
  • Partnership: For businesses owned by two or more individuals.
  • Limited Liability Company (LLC): Offers liability protection with flexible tax options.
  • Corporation: Suitable for larger businesses seeking investment and offering strong liability protection.

Once you've selected your structure, register your business with the appropriate government agencies, obtain necessary licenses or permits, and secure your Employer Identification Number (EIN) if applicable.

Secure Funding for Your Business

Funding is a critical step to turn your business plan into reality. Explore various sources of capital depending on your needs and business type.

  • Personal savings: Using your own funds is often the first step.
  • Family and friends: Seek investments or loans from trusted contacts.
  • Bank loans: Traditional financing options with fixed repayment terms.
  • Angel investors and venture capital: For high-growth startups seeking significant funding.
  • Government grants and programs: Local, state, or federal grants supporting small businesses.
  • Crowdfunding: Platforms like Kickstarter or Indiegogo help raise funds from the public.

Set Up Your Business Operations

Establishing a solid operational foundation is essential for efficiency and scalability. This includes choosing a location, setting up systems, and procuring necessary equipment and supplies.

  • Location selection: Decide between a physical storefront, office, or home-based setup.
  • Register domain and build a website: Establish your online presence with a professional website.
  • Set up banking and accounting: Open business bank accounts and implement accounting software or hire an accountant.
  • Develop operational processes: Create workflows for production, sales, customer service, and other key functions.
  • Procure supplies and equipment: Purchase necessary tools, inventory, and technology.

Build Your Brand and Market Your Business

Effective branding and marketing are critical to attracting customers and establishing a presence in your industry.

  • Create a compelling brand identity: Design a logo, choose brand colors, and craft your brand message.
  • Develop a marketing strategy: Use a mix of online and offline marketing channels, including social media, email campaigns, content marketing, and local advertising.
  • Leverage digital marketing: Optimize your website for search engines (SEO), run targeted ads, and engage with your audience on social media platforms.
  • Build customer relationships: Implement excellent customer service practices and encourage reviews and referrals.

Launch Your Business

With all preparations in place, you are ready for the exciting moment of launching your business. Create a launch plan to generate buzz and attract initial customers.

  • Plan a launch event or promotion: Offer special deals or host an opening event to draw attention.
  • Announce your launch: Use press releases, social media, and email marketing to inform your network.
  • Gather feedback: Listen to early customer feedback and make adjustments as needed.

Monitor, Grow, and Sustain Your Business

Starting is just the beginning. Continuous monitoring, adaptation, and growth strategies will ensure your business remains competitive and profitable.

  • Track key metrics: Monitor sales, expenses, customer satisfaction, and other vital indicators.
  • Adjust your strategies: Use data insights to refine marketing, operations, and product offerings.
  • Invest in growth: Expand your product line, enter new markets, or increase marketing efforts.
  • Build a strong team: Hire skilled employees and foster a positive work culture.
  • Stay compliant: Keep up with legal requirements, taxes, and industry regulations.
